With the access and affordability of online learning, now is a perfect time to pick up a new skill. Whether you are job searching, going up for a promotion, or just trying to better yourself, online certifications are a fantastic way to distinguish yourself during the hiring process and boost your resume and career.
According to Indeed, a certification is “a credential that demonstrates that you have the knowledge, experience, and specific skills needed for a specific field or job.”
While certifications are not the same as a professional license, certifications “assess and verify that a person has proficiency or even has mastered certain abilities and skills.” In turn, these skills can also then be applied to advance and grow in your career.
There are many options of online certifications available. With such a wide selection and number of choices, it is easy to get overwhelmed when seeking out which certification to pursue. Before you proceed with enrolling in an online certification program, remember that there are steps you should take before investing your time (and money, if applicable).
Of course, you want to spend your time (and possibly, money) wisely. So it is very important that you take time to do your research in advance to ensure you are selecting the select right certification for you, and a legitimate certification.

Due to COVID-19, higher education has implemented many changes regarding modes of instruction. Check with your local and state universities to see if they are offering any certifications or courses online. There is a chance that certifications that were previously only offered in-person, are now available online.
Note: Even if you have every good intention in the world, not all certifications are worth your time.
As you are doing research, trust your gut – if it seems too good to be true (A.k.a. if it is an extremely low time commitment or cost), then it is likely not a legitimate or well-respected certification.

First thing’s first: research! Ensure that you have taken the time to do your research before proceeding with an online certification. That way, this investment in yourself is worthwhile and beneficial.
Speak with your supervisor and other professionals in the field about recommended certifications to pursue. Often times, the company will even cover the cost if it pertains to your current position.
Take a look at your local and state universities to see if they are offering any certifications or courses online.
Just as doing the research takes time, so does the certification itself; reputable certifications take time to complete. After choosing the right certification for you, be patient as you move forward with it. In order to retain as much information as possible, try not to rush through the process. You will get out of it what you put into it!
